Cashmere Post-Shave Body Cream is a cream-type body cream applied to the entire body after showering or hair removal. Based on shea butter, the thick texture adheres to the skin and manages it without feeling heavy. It fits well when you want to comfortably care for arms and legs that are prone to dryness and sensitive skin.
